Independent products. Built end to end.

We build and ship our own software from Tokyo. Two products are in development right now. Untamed Ehizia is an experimental MMORPG that runs on a single shared world, and Duolve is a dating app built around live-voice experience rooms.

We design and engineer both of them ourselves. That covers the persistent world state, the multiplayer networking, the real-time voice, the progression and economy systems, and the localised web front ends. We also run the infrastructure and the release pipelines that get each build out.

Experimental MMORPG In beta testing

Untamed Ehizia

Untamed Ehizia is an indie experimental MMORPG where social interaction is elevated to a new level. It is a friendly, cozy world, and every part of the game is played alongside someone else.

The whole game runs on one shared world, with no instancing. Quests are not personalised, every NPC holds the same state for everyone, and if you open a door it stays open for the next player who walks through. We built the game around cooperation instead of conflict, and we kept the kind of friction that gets people talking to each other.

  • Shared, non-instanced world. What you do changes the world for everyone else playing in it.
  • PvE-first. Cooperation drives the game. PvP is available only in a few tightly defined situations.
  • No auto-party, no auctions. You find teammates on advertising boards and in bars and markets, and you agree every trade directly with the other player.
  • Secret spells and abilities. Some skills are rare enough that tracking down the player who has one becomes a quest of its own.
  • Split progression. Unlocking skills widens what you can do, and raising stats improves what you already have. The two advance separately.
  • Unbalanced by design. Every class plays differently and fills a different social role.
Dating app Launching soon

Duolve

Duolve is a new way to date. You discover compatibility through shared experiences, and you feel the connection before you ever meet.

Instead of endless swiping, Duolve gives two people something to do together. You solve a puzzle, work through a dilemma or write a story, and you talk over live voice the whole time. A profile only shows what someone chose to put in it. An hour spent working on something together shows you far more.

  • Nine experience rooms. They span five categories: problem solving, deep conversation, creative, decisions and values, and connection.
  • Live voice throughout. You start talking the moment the room opens, so nobody spends a week texting first.
  • No swiping and no scores. Browse profiles or take a random match, then pick a room and start.
  • The conversation has somewhere to go. Because you are busy doing something, you never have to invent an opening line.
  • A better first date. By the time you meet in person you have already had a real conversation.
  • Safety by default. Conversations stay private, and you can block, report or unmatch at any time.

The idea behind both

Both products come from the same idea. Software gets interesting when there are other people in it. Untamed Ehizia will not hide other players behind instancing, and Duolve gives you a better way to judge someone than a photograph.

We keep both projects small and deliberate. There is no outside roadmap and no committee to answer to, so we can cut anything that adds complexity without adding value.
